Output 64699c818500c54d80a62d5c3a4a735b0630865a65a27ad039ebf61dbf1252b1:0

value
454800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70413127ba6e46b5a213bce185d260ab89051624 OP_EQUAL
address
3BvZhec9YGt8fYK6oXqWZac72T88zQtiiH
transaction
64699c818500c54d80a62d5c3a4a735b0630865a65a27ad039ebf61dbf1252b1
confirmations
205062
spent
true